Operation Yukthiya: Over 2,100 arrests in 24 hours
Sri Lankan authorities launched Operation Yukthiya ('Justice'), a nationwide anti-drug and anti-underworld crackdown coordinated between Sri Lanka Police, the Narcotics Bureau, Special Bureau, Armed Forces, and the Police Special Task Force. In its first 24 hours, 2,121 individuals were arrested (2,020 men, 101 women), 12 detained under detention orders, and 133 referred for rehabilitation. Cannabis was the dominant drug seized at 178 kg. Western Province accounted for the highest concentration of arrests. The operation deployed 200 army personnel, 200 police officers, and 50 STF members.
